Common Lawn Fertilizing Service Jobs
Basic Fertilization - provides essential nutrients to promote healthy lawn growth.
Weed Control - helps reduce weeds and maintain a uniform grass appearance.
Seasonal Feeding - supports lawn health through tailored fertilizing schedules.
Soil Testing - identifies nutrient deficiencies for targeted fertilization.
Granular Application - delivers nutrients evenly across the lawn surface.
Liquid Fertilizing - offers quick absorption for rapid lawn response.
Lawn Fertilizing Service Questions
What is lawn fertilizing service? It involves applying nutrients to promote healthy grass growth and improve overall lawn appearance.
How often should a lawn be fertilized? Typically, lawns benefit from fertilization during the growing season, often every 6 to 8 weeks.
What types of fertilizers are used? A variety of fertilizers, including granular and liquid options, are used depending on the lawn’s needs and soil conditions.
Why is fertilizing important for my lawn? Proper fertilization helps maintain a lush, green lawn and can improve resistance to pests and diseases.
